I was gonna say it will sell more easily if you but it up but it seems your business acumen is greater than mine.

As it is quite large and heavy shipping won’t be too cheap. Unless it fits in a flat rate box.

It is also uncut and in log form so the buyer doesn’t know what it contains. Considering both I would price it lower than is normal for figured maple.
 
What's the size on the piece in the second pic? If that log was mine, I'd saw in 3" slabs then cut into bowl and spindle blanks
 
Looks a lot like some figured but not flamed box elder trunk I have cut up. The burls very often showed pink at the very least in what I was cutting. If it had a few areas of pale peach , I would say it also matched some willow I have cut.
